What's The Definition Of Hamadryad?
[n] large cobra of southeastern Asia and the East Indies; the largest venomous snake; sometimes placed in genus Naja

1. (Class. Myth.) A tree nymph whose life ended with that of
the particular tree, usually an oak, which had been her
abode.
2. (Zo["o]l.) A large venomous East Indian snake
({Orhiophagus bungarus}), allied to the cobras.
